Signs That Indicate You Need Tree Removal Services
When a tree displays significant structural problems or health deterioration, it's essential to identify the indicators that show removal is needed. You need to examine for significant root damage, which often appears as fungal formations at the base or noticeable root system instability. Root damage undermines tree stability, elevating the likelihood of sudden failure. Trees that lean, especially those with fresh shifts in position or soil upheaval around the base, may suggest reduced structural strength due to root damage or weather damage. Lifeless or suspended limbs, trunk lesions, and significant bark loss are more symptoms of advanced decline. Never overlook hollow trunks or major voids, as these decrease structural strength. Swift removal of hazardous trees stops structural damage and enhances environmental safety for both people and structures.

Key Practices for Seasonal Pruning
In terms of maintaining healthy trees in the Rochester Hills and Troy area, precise seasonal pruning is essential in encouraging robust growth, structural integrity, and disease resistance. It's important to use appropriate pruning techniques, like crown thinning to increase light penetration and air flow, as well as crown raising to remove low-hanging branches. Pay attention to seasonal timing—the best time is late winter or early spring for most species, during tree dormancy and less susceptible to stress. Stay away from heavy pruning in late summer or during growth periods, which might cause undesirable regrowth or vulnerability to environmental stresses. Ensure clean cuts just outside the branch collar to facilitate rapid wound closure. By following these best practices, you'll enhance the beauty and lifespan of your landscape while reducing potential hazards.
Pest and Disease Control
In addition to proper pruning practices, proper disease and pest management safeguards the health and importance of your trees in Rochester Hills and Troy. You should regularly inspect your trees for symptoms such as leaf discoloration, cankers, dieback, and abnormal growths—these can point to underlying pathogens or infestation. Proper disease diagnosis is crucial, enabling you to implement focused treatments that minimize damage and prevent recurrence. Complete pest prevention strategies, including proper sanitation, biological controls, and careful application of arboricultural treatments, minimize the risk of insect outbreaks like emerald ash borer or website scale insects. By taking action promptly and using scientifically-supported interventions, you protect the structural integrity and vitality of your landscape. Focus on a proactive approach to disease and pest management to help your trees grow strong year-round.
Nurturing Proper Growth
Although trees establish natural growth patterns, careful trimming and upkeep are vital for ensuring healthy formation and avoiding weakness problems. You should implement formative pruning during young tree development to encourage well-distributed branches and strong scaffold limbs. By strategically cutting crossed limbs and competing tops, you'll reduce the chance of co-dominant stems and potential failure. Periodic crown reduction improves sunlight exposure and airflow, which promotes vigorous root growth and balanced canopy expansion. You must eliminate deceased and unhealthy wood quickly to ensure tree vigor and structural integrity. Following regular care routines optimizes nutrient allocation and enables continuous health. Through implementing these expert methods, you ensure your trees maintain both aesthetic appeal and lasting vitality, reducing possible risks and costly interventions.
Safety Requirements and Equipment Guidelines
Because of tree removal presents significant hazards, professional companies in Rochester Hills and Troy follow rigorous safety standards and utilize advanced equipment. It's important to note that certified arborists carry out a thorough hazard assessment ahead of any tree removal or tree pruning starts. This evaluation detects weak points, unhealthy branches, and proximity to power lines or property structures. Workers rely on personal protective equipment (PPE), consisting of helmets, chainsaw-resistant clothing, and safety harnesses to reduce dangers.
Professional gear such as hydraulic lifts, rigging apparatus, and precision cutting tools enables safe dismantling of substantial vegetation. Ground teams use wood processors and stump elimination tools to efficiently manage waste material and tree stumps. By following ANSI Z133 safety guidelines and implementing state-of-the-art botanical tools, you can rest assured that each procedure focuses on both worker safety and landscape protection.
